AgION Technologies, L.L.C. Partners with Stryker Instruments to Introduce FDA 510k Cleared Catheters

WAKEFIELD, Mass.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Agion Technologies, Inc., the worldwide leader in naturally-safe, silver-based antimicrobial solutions, today announced it has signed an agreement with Stryker Corporation’s Instruments Division to incorporate Agion’s natural antimicrobial technology into a new pain management catheter. The product, Silver ExFen Catheter, has achieved FDA 510K clearance and will be marketed in the US.

“Since Medicare and Medicaid will no longer pay for preventable Surgical Site Infections (SSI), products like the Stryker antimicrobial catheter will become a critical tool for the medical profession,” said Paul Ford, chief executive officer of Agion Technologies. “This partnership is another innovative application of our powerful, natural technology, and sets a standard for the industry to follow.”

Agion’s innovative antimicrobial technology is based on naturally-occurring silver, a powerful antimicrobial element. Silver is integrated into the polymer blend of the catheter and is not affected by abrasions to the surface. Agion’s antimicrobial protection lasts for the life of the product.

About Agion Technologies, Inc.

Agion Technologies, located in Wakefield, Massachusetts, is a leader in providing customized, natural, antimicrobial solutions based on silver that continuously inhibits the growth of bacteria, mold and fungus. Agion’s antimicrobial technology is used in consumer, industrial and healthcare industries and has been incorporated into a variety of products including cell phones, shoes, keyboards, water filters, medical catheters, and ice machines. Agion's customers include many leading brands such as Motorola, PPG, Carrier, DuPont, Adidas, Scotsman, Stanley Bostitch and Oster. About Stryker Corporation

Stryker Corporation is one of the world's leading medical technology companies with the most broadly based range of products in orthopedics and a significant presence in other medical specialties. Stryker works with respected medical professionals to help people lead more active and more satisfying lives. The Company's products include implants used in joint replacement, trauma, craniomaxillofacial and spinal surgeries; biologics; surgical, neurologic, ear, nose & throat and interventional pain equipment; and endoscopic, surgical navigation, communications and digital imaging systems; as well as patient handling and emergency medical equipment.
